Turkish First Lady Urges Melania Trump to Advocate for Gaza's Children Amid Ongoing Crisis

Emine Erdogan appeals to Melania Trump, drawing parallels between the plight of Gaza's children and those affected by the Ukraine invasion, as humanitarian conditions worsen in the region.


The Turkish first lady, Emine Erdogan, has sent a heartfelt letter to Melania Trump, calling for advocacy and attention towards the humanitarian crisis in Gaza, where children are severely affected by famine and conflict. She emphasized the need for a unified voice in addressing the injustices faced by Palestinian children, prompting discourse on international response and solidarity.


The first lady of Turkey, Emine Erdogan, has taken a notable step by appealing to Melania Trump, the former US first lady, to advocate for the suffering children in Gaza amid the ongoing conflict with Israel. In a letter released by the Turkish presidency on Saturday, Mrs. Erdogan commended Mrs. Trump's previous humanitarian efforts regarding children impacted by the war in Ukraine, urging her to redirect some of that advocacy towards Gaza, which she described as a "children's cemetery."

The call to action stems from a grim assessment by UN-backed food security experts, who have declared a famine affecting approximately half a million individuals in Gaza City. The Integrated Food Security Phase Classification (IPC) report highlights alarming statistics, including that nearly one in three children in Gaza are facing acute malnutrition, with an estimated 132,000 children under five projected to be threatened by malnutrition through June 2026.

In her letter, Mrs. Erdogan poignantly remarked on the tragic realities of affected children's lives, noting the phrase "unknown baby" inscribed on shrouds of deceased Gazan children—a statement she believes stirs deep moral outrage. Moreover, she urged Mrs. Trump to extend her concern beyond the borders of Ukraine and to also engage with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u to alleviate the worsening humanitarian conditions in Gaza.

While typically focused on environmental issues and not actively involved in political discourse, Mrs. Erdogan has expressed herself in writing to various global leaders about crises in the past, seeking to draw attention to suffering in regions like Syria and calling out Israel's actions in Gaza earlier this year. This recent letter comes in the wake of significant Israeli military operations initiated following Hamas's attack on southern Israel, which resulted in substantial loss of life.

Despite the unfolding humanitarian catastrophe, Israel has denied claims of famine in Gaza, criticizing the methodologies employed by IPC experts and accusing them of bias, asserting that the data used comes from Hamas. The IPC stands by its findings, emphasizing the dire situation, especially among children, facing severe food shortages.

In the aftermath of sustained military operations and increasing casualty counts— with recent reports indicating over 61 fatalities within just the past day alone amid continuing airstrikes—the humanitarian situation in Gaza remains precarious. Over 62,000 individuals have reportedly succumbed to the violence since the onset of military actions in October.
